Photos: Wonderland

Sun, 17 Oct 2010 | By karenoc | Photo Gallery

Richmond Park is the biggest park in London, and even locals don't know about it... 1000 hectares let you wonder, bike, walk or just rest. In spring an azaleas explosion takes place in Isabella's Plantation, and a magic place blooms.
